Output 6dc25498b1ef06a384774dbbdab04a12d2e4f573af10e2e188f710e20638a012:3

value
479833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d52eb908a1ddda2daeffc9b9bc03df31107b8c OP_EQUAL
address
37EfrEXoT5KAMJKJFz8EdHDhTay1vHFQ2W
transaction
6dc25498b1ef06a384774dbbdab04a12d2e4f573af10e2e188f710e20638a012
spent
true